Induction hobs

Induction hobs have smooth, flat surfaces that are simpler than gas hobs to clean. They require less energy and also offer precise temperature control, making them ideal for delicate sauces and searing meats. They also cool down quickly, so you don't burn your fingers when you touch the surface. But, it's important to remember that you'll need a compatible cookware set to use them. They aren't recommended for those who wear pacemakers because the electromagnetic field generated by induction may cause interference with medical devices.

Induction hobs usually have indicators that show power levels and settings. This gives your kitchen an edgy look. Some models come with bridge zones, which permit you to combine cooking areas in order to accommodate larger pans. This makes them a great option for grilling pans and griddles. Certain models come with a boost feature that temporarily boosts power output in a zone. This allows you to quickly bring water to a boil, or sear your meat.

A residual heat indicator is a useful feature. It will show when the stove is still hot, even after it has been turned off. This feature can prevent accidental burns in homes with young children. Some cooktops are also equipped with child locks to keep your little ones safe while you're cooking.

Gas hobs

Gas hobs have become an essential feature in UK kitchens due to their ability to quickly heat up and control the temperature precisely. They also sport an elegant and professional appearance that can be integrated into many different kitchen styles. In addition, most modern gas hobs feature automatic ignition. This means that turning on the stove creates an electric spark to ignite the gas inside the burner. This is more secure than older gas hobs that required matchboxes and lighters. The visual flame indicator of gas hobs also helps to determine whether the flame is on or off, which can help prevent accidental burns and gas leaks.

Gas hobs come in a variety of styles from basic single-burner models to powerful, wide wok burners. Some models even include dual flame burners that permit you to alter the size of the flame as well as precisely manage the heat. Other features include a vortex flame that eliminates heat loss from the sides of the burner, and a sleek, toughened glass surface that's easy to clean.

Hobs with solid-plate construction

Providing a simple yet reliable cooking solution, solid plate hobs have been the most popular choice for many homes over the decades. They work by heating up flat metal plates with electricity, which makes them an affordable option that is easy to use and clean. However, their basic design may not be as energy efficient than other hob types, leading to higher electric bills. They also take longer to heat and cool than other hobs. This can be frustrating for those who cook more quickly.

Solid plate hobs are a good choice for those on a budget. They offer even heating and are compatible with all kinds of pots. They also feature simple dial controls to regulate the temperature. Additionally, they typically feature indicators that let you know when the plate is hot or turned on, which increases security.

The solid plate design is prone to electrical short-circuits, and could require more maintenance than other hobs. They also don't offer as much flexibility as other hob types such as induction or ceramic and are difficult to clean due to their exposed metal plates.

While they can be a good budget option however, solid plate hobs are being replaced by more modern options like induction and ceramic. They are more efficient in energy consumption and provide modern design options that match your kitchen's aesthetic. Ceramic hobs

Ceramic hobs are elegant and fashionable. They are a popular option for modern kitchens. They are also cheaper than other kinds due to their flat surface. They are also energy efficient since the heating elements only heat up the surface of the hob not the pans that sit that sit on top.

As with induction hobs and ceramic ones come with many features to simplify cooking and make it more efficient. Certain models, like, have a FlexiDuo feature that allows you to combine two cooking zones into one space to be able to handle larger pots. These models are also fitted with residual temperature indicators as well as child locks in order to keep your children safe.

The major difference between an induction and ceramic hob is that a ceramic hob does not use magnetic fields to warm the pans. Instead, they employ electric heating elements beneath each cooking zone. This means that they can take a bit longer heat up and cool down than induction hobs. They have a great record in terms of energy efficiency.

They're more expensive than gas hobs and solid-plate hobs, but they have numerous advantages that make them worth it. They are easy to clean, and since they don't contain open flames, they are less likely to burn your hands. They're also more efficient than gas hobs and ovens, and are more sustainable, as they don't consume the same amount of energy over time.
